How to Use a Zap Gun: A Comprehensive Guide
A zap gun, also known as a stun gun or electroshock weapon, is a non-lethal device designed to temporarily incapacitate an attacker. It is an effective self-defense tool that can be used by individuals who want to protect themselves from harm. In this article, we will provide a step-by-step guide on how to use a zap gun safely and effectively.
Before Using a Zap Gun
Before using a zap gun, it is essential to understand the following:
- Know the laws: Familiarize yourself with the laws in your state or country regarding the use of electroshock weapons. Some states have specific regulations or restrictions on the use of zap guns.
- Understand the device: Read the user manual and understand how the zap gun works, including its features, settings, and any safety precautions.
- Practice and training: It is recommended to practice using the zap gun in a controlled environment to ensure you are comfortable and proficient with its use.
